Your impact, with us As our highly valued Technical Support Specialist, you’ll use your technical expertise to provide reliable IT support across multiple clinical and business systems, aiding patients with a wide range of heart and cardiovascular conditions. Based in Perth you’ll ensure seamless IT service delivery, supporting frontline healthcare professionals to deliver patient-centred care, helping to improve people’s health and lives and shaping our organisation’s future. Responsibilities - Providing first and second-level support for IT hardware, software, and clinical applications. - Troubleshooting and resolving incidents across Microsoft 365, Windows 10/11, networking, telephony, and printing. - Supporting clinical systems such as EMR and PACS/DICOM applications. - Collaborating with IT colleagues, vendors, and clinical staff to deliver effective solutions. - Documenting solutions, knowledge articles, and contributing to IT projects, migrations, and upgrades. Qualifications To succeed in this role, you will have: - 3+ years of IT support experience, ideally in a healthcare or clinical environment. - Proficiency in Microsoft 365, Active Directory, endpoint management, and ITSM/RMM tools. -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ills. - Excellent verbal and written communication, with a customer-focused approach.
